Output bba8cc9bbe4f658edda3a945efac17ab0c4b71681c57e17c4d6b424641bcf88b:19

value
2441073
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2bf270e70120e3d871bed81e31608bc4568e6976 OP_EQUAL
address
35hPQtapycgWy52Z5SYn9oRk3zgcrXaPHa
transaction
bba8cc9bbe4f658edda3a945efac17ab0c4b71681c57e17c4d6b424641bcf88b
confirmations
277390
spent
true